Output 8eb92de5f88c231f08c767ff8e5fe48440b8bccc263175a1620e94ed65902070:5

value
25245300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85a36e44dd80514d2ee36fced1fea432b97ef056 OP_EQUAL
address
3DsdaRYVE9Pmfk8hrmwHPwPwPawPK9A9Xr
transaction
8eb92de5f88c231f08c767ff8e5fe48440b8bccc263175a1620e94ed65902070
spent
true